Consultant applicants have rated the interview process at CGI with 3 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 57% positive. To compare, the company-average is 60.7%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Consultant roles take an average of 15 days to get hired, when considering 7 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at CGI overall takes an average of 35 days.
Common stages of the interview process at CGI as a Consultant according to 7 Glassdoor interviews include:
One on one interview: 40%
Group panel interview: 20%
Background check: 10%
Phone interview: 10%
Other: 10%
Skills test: 10%

I applied through an employee referral.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at CGI in Oct 2014
Interview
Spoke with hiring manager, technical manager, consulting manager, then VP over the group. Somewhat informative, not a very difficult interview in terms of skill review or experience questions. Each interviewer spent more time talking about the group and the product than they did asking me questions. The group was somewhat misrepresented during the interview process.
